On Fri, May 06, 2005 at 07:37:07AM +0300, Alin Nastac wrote: > I know only one mirror network who could worth the hassle: cpan. > Perl has a nice geographically distributed network of mirrors. Too bad > portage can't automatically select the closest cpan mirror. :( You can already put in specific mirrors to use via /etc/portage/mirrors
So just write up some changes to mirrorselect that can populate that file by selecting the optimum choices from profiles/thirdpartymirrors. -- Robin Hugh Johnson E-Mail : [EMAIL PROTECTED] Home Page : http://www.orbis-terrarum.net/?l=people.robbat2 ICQ# : 30269588 or 41961639 GnuPG FP : 11AC BA4F 4778 E3F6 E4ED F38E B27B 944E 3488 4E85
